The District's Famous Library


collection books, originally uploaded by margosita.

I like to refer to DC as "The District." I'm not sure why. I refer to SF as, well, "SF", so it's not as though I'm against using city initials. Maybe it is because The District sounds a bit more regal. The Library of Congress was pretty regal, all tall columns and meticulously painted ceilings, carved staircases, marble and U's written as V's.
